Norfolk rockers The Sharps unveil their new, five-piece line up at The Waterfront on Saturday 7th September, as part of the Tilting Sky Festival. Since February the band has gone under cover, working with former record producer George Nicholson on a whole new sound, their brief appearances limited to acoustic slots at local festivals and venues, where they’ve tried out some of their new songs.

Released on 21st January 2013, The Sharps debut EP ‘Road Movies’ includes the band’s two single releases – ‘My Love Ain’t Gonna Save You’ (http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=pqL84WDO_5A) and ‘Cage Of Love’ (http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=NBm9a_HgV5Y) – along with three previously unreleased tracks. Both singles’ music videos were shot by the band in and around Norfolk. ‘Cage of Love’ follows a road movie storyline, with a final sequence that parodies the ending of ‘Thelma & Louise’. The band has just finished recording their debut E.P at Headline Music Studios in Cambridge. Entitled ‘Road Movies’, it will be released on December 10th. Along with ‘Cage of Love’, it features three new songs and a re-mastered version of their previous single, ‘My Love Ain’t Gonna Save You’.
